NFT Games Explored: NFT games have gained immense traction, offering players the ability to own, trade, and sell in-game assets as digital collectibles. This innovative concept has attracted a massive audience and opened up new ways for game developers to monetize their creations. However, as the popularity of these games grows, so does the opportunity for malicious actors to exploit unsuspecting players. Theft and Fraud: One of the primary concerns associated with NFT games is the potential for theft and fraud. With valuable assets stored as digital tokens on blockchain networks, hackers may attempt to exploit vulnerabilities in the system or trick players into revealing their private keys. Furthermore, counterfeit assets or fake listings can deceive players into purchasing worthless items, leading to financial losses and a sense of betrayal within the gaming community. Voice Cloning and Synthesis: While voice cloning and synthesis technologies have found extensive applications in various fields, including entertainment and accessibility, they also pose ethical and security risks. These technologies allow the replication of an individual's voice with uncanny precision, enabling the creation of convincing synthetic voices indistinguishable from the originals. This opens the doors to potential misuse, misinformation, and identity theft. Trustworthiness of Synthetic Voices: Synthetic voices created through voice cloning or synthesis can be utilized to deceive unsuspecting individuals. By impersonating someone's voice, a malicious actor could spread misinformation, fabricate evidence, or engage in social engineering attacks. Imagine receiving a call from what appears to be your bank, where an artificially-generated voice convincingly requests your personal information. The consequences of falling victim to such deception can be severe. Privacy and Data Security: The generation of synthetic voices often requires large amounts of voice data. Unauthorized access to such data can compromise an individual's privacy and result in a breach of personal information. Imagine if your voice data gets stolen, allowing someone to craft a synthetic voice indistinguishable from your own. The implications for identity theft and fraud are significant, underscoring the need for stringent security measures. Mitigating the Risks: While the potential dangers surrounding NFT games and voice cloning/synthesis cannot be ignored, there are proactive steps that can be taken to mitigate the risks: 1. Enhanced Security Measures: NFT game developers should prioritize robust security protocols to protect players' assets and personal data. This can include measures like multi-factor authentication, secure storage of private keys, and regular audits of smart contracts. 2. User Education: Players must be educated about the risks associated with NFT games and trained to identify potential scams or fraudulent activities. Raising awareness within the gaming community can go a long way in preventing unnecessary losses. 3. Ethical Considerations: Developers and users of voice cloning and synthesis technologies should follow ethical guidelines that prioritize consent, transparency, and responsible use. A code of ethics can help ensure that these technologies are leveraged for beneficial purposes while safeguarding against potential harm.
